Output 87f80053bef5e077de22333467fcc8a79808b9e0f6091fd7e1d1cfa40f0c816c:0

value
529889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643e08642e880a719ec90f6ea54a8c7453b13e6b OP_EQUAL
address
3Aq3oqfQCysFANTTeCJjDSPFoh3SMLSa3i
transaction
87f80053bef5e077de22333467fcc8a79808b9e0f6091fd7e1d1cfa40f0c816c
confirmations
424259
spent
true

1 Sat Range